Experience London's festive lights on a Christmas Eve guided coach tour, see iconic landmarks illuminated, and enjoy a festive gift, all in about 1 hour 45 minutes.
The London Christmas Eve Illuminations Guided Tour by Night offers a unique way to celebrate the holiday season, especially for those eager to witness London’s legendary festive lights. Priced at $94.59 per person, this nearly two-hour nighttime coach journey explores some of London’s most famous sights, beautifully lit up for Christmas. The tour departs from Victoria Coach Station at 6:30 pm, making it an ideal activity for an early Christmas Eve evening.
While the tour primarily focuses on viewing the city’s stunning Christmas illuminations and landmarks such as Buckingham Palace, the Tower of London, and the London Eye, it also features engaging narration from a knowledgeable guide. One notable highlight is the inclusion of a Christmas gift, adding a warm holiday touch.
However, potential participants should note that this is a coach tour with fixed stops, not a hop-on-hop-off experience, and food or beverages are not included, unless specified. The modern, clean vehicles ensure comfort, but the tour’s emphasis on sightseeing means it’s best suited for those comfortable with a moderate physical level and sitting for an extended period.

What time does the tour start?
The tour departs from Bulleid Way at 6:30 pm, with check-in at 6:15 pm.
How long does the tour last?
The tour lasts approximately 1 hour 45 minutes.
What landmarks will I see?
You visit Buckingham Palace, Tower of London, London Eye, Westminster Abbey, Big Ben, Trafalgar Square, and St Paul’s Cathedral, among others.
Is hotel pickup included?
No, hotel pickup and drop-off are not included. The meeting point is Bulleid Way.
What is included in the price?
The price covers the guided tour, panoramic night views, famous sites, a Christmas gift, and luxury coach transportation.
Can I hop on and off at different stops?
No, this is a fixed-route coach tour; hopping on and off is not permitted.
Are food and beverages provided?
No, food and drinks are not included unless otherwise specified.
Is this tour suitable for children or people with limited mobility?
It is suitable for those with moderate physical fitness; mobility limitations may require additional consideration.
How many people are in each group?
The tour limits group size to a maximum of 52 travelers.
